Environmental engineering: M.Tech
2-year programme:
If you are desired to protect the environment, maintain health and sanitation, sewage lines development, river conservation, soil conservation, curbing of air, water, and land pollution, etc. then you should opt for the environmental engineering branch.
After the ill impacts of the climate change and our visionary statement in Paris climate summit, this branch got a flip across the country, because the government is recruiting numerous candidates for an environmental engineer, environment specialist, and also to the direct recruitment in the Central pollution control board, state pollution control board.
Apart from the government jobs world class NGO and organizations like IUCN, BNHS, TNVS, WWI, WTI, etc.
Municipal corporation engineering department JOBS, public health engineering dept., are some other fields where environmental engineers are inevitable.
The various subjects you have to study in this branch, listed below:
Environmental mathematics
Environmental chemistry
Environmental microbiology
Principles and designs of physio- chemical treatment plants
Environmental impact assessments
Soil hazards and waste management
Environmental health and safety in industries
Major projects and field works
